
How AI Startups Can Futureproof Themselves As Business Models Change
About this episode
In this episode, Andrew Davis and Chris Branch discuss the challenges that small startups face when big players enter the market and when technology becomes open source. They explore the impact of these factors on the AI industry and how startups can pivot to protect themselves. The conversation highlights the importance of building communities, partnering with big brands, and hosting competitions to engage users and establish a strong presence. The hosts also emphasize the need for startups to future-proof themselves and find unique ways to differentiate their products and assets.
